Abstract

The invention relates to an infrared gas alarm and a gas concentration detection method. The infrared gas alarm comprises a light source end for outputting infrared light and a detection end for receiving and detecting the infrared light emitted by the light source end, and also comprises a turntable positioned between the light source end and the detection end; the turntable is provided with a test hole site and a plurality of correction hole sites, the test hole site comprises a test channel and a reference channel, and the test channel and the reference channel are respectively provided with optical filters corresponding to different wavelengths; and correction optical filters with equal wavelength intervals are sequentially arranged on the plurality of correction hole sites. According to the infrared gas alarm and the gas concentration detection method, the voltage-wavelength curve is obtained by fitting the output voltage of the detector corresponding to the plurality of correction hole sites, and the voltage is in direct proportion to the light intensity, so that the change of the light intensity of the test channel and the reference channel caused by spectral offset can correspond to the change of the output voltage; and a more accurate gas concentration value can be obtained after correction.

Description

technical field [0001] The invention belongs to the technical field of gas concentration detection, and in particular relates to an infrared gas alarm and a gas concentration detection method. Background technique [0002] With the improvement of people's safety awareness, gas has gradually been paid attention to by people as a source of danger, and various gas alarms have gradually entered people's lives. However, if the light source of the alarm is used for too long, its central wavelength will shift, resulting in a shift of the light source spectrum. At this time, the light intensity corresponding to the wavelength of the detection channel gas and the reference channel wavelength of the alarm will change, but the infrared gas alarm The sensor still calculates according to the original setting of the proportional coefficient, resulting in a deviation in the detection.
